We study the minimal geometric deformation decoupling in 2+1 dimensional space--times and implement it as a tool for obtaining anisotropic solutions from isotropic geometries. Interestingly, both the isotropic and the anisotropic sector fulfill Einstein field equations in contrast to the cases studied in 3+1 dimensions. In particular, new anisotropic solutions are obtained from the well known static BTZ solution.
